型钢矫直机托辊装置的优化与改进

摘    要:针对悬臂辊式矫直机的结构特点及使用中存在的问题,从完善其使用功能出发,设计完成了型材矫直托辊装置,并在生产实践中不断对其进行改进完善,不仅较好地解决了中、小型材在离线精整矫直过程中发生的头、尾部漏矫现象,还解决了单只轧件在生产矫直运行中存在的“脱尾”问题,使得后续精整工序更合理流畅,生产作业效率也有了较大提高。由于不再对矫直后的型材头尾部进行二次锯切,故较大幅度提高了产品的成材率,降低了相关辅材的消耗,节省了生产现场二次倒运堆放场地,产品质量有了明显提高。

Optimization and Improvement on Roll Style straightening Machine for Section Steel

Abstract:According to the structural characteristics and the problem existing in the application of cantilever style straightening machine, and in order to improve the use function, the roll style straightening machine was designed. Moreover the machine was improved continuously in the practice. This machine not only can solve the missing straightening situation on the head and tail for small section steel during offline accurate straightening process, but also can solve the problem of tail off during the straightening process for single rolling piece. By this machine, the accurate straightening process can be more reasonable, and the productive efficiency can be enhanced. For this machine eliminating the need for the second cut on the head and tail of the section steel that after straightening, the yield efficiency can be improved greatly, meanwhile the consumption of the supplementary material is lower, the stacking space for secondary movement is saved. Finally, the production quality is improved obviously.
